Would You like to Be a Volunteer This Summer?
Here are the requirements:
You must be at least 16 years of age and have a signed release from your parents.
You will be given 1/2 week at camp for every week you work. You can use these weeks yourself or give them away to someone else.
Here are the rules you must be willing to follow:
- All our helpers must understand that they are workers in the camp and not campers for the week or weeks that they work. (That is to say that your main purpose for being at the camp will be to work for the Lord with others of us in the camp.) You will be given free time when your work is finished and you are dismissed. Your free time activities should not distract the campers from the director's program. If you wish to take part in the camp activities, you may do so only with permission from your supervisor and the director.
- While on duty, you will be under a supervisor. In the kitchen, that supervisor will be the cooks or the dining room manager. For field work, your supervisor will be Dan or his assistant. During your off-duty time you will be subject to the authority of the director and any rules that he imposes, such as quiet time, etc.
- There will be a curfew for you simply because your work demands a good nights sleep.
- A positive attitude is a must. Any problems or complaints should be discussed with your supervisor or with Dan.
- While at camp, you must be flexible. Some days you will be needed in different areas of work. Other days, you may have a special project as well as your regular routine.
- Your work week will begin at 3:30 on Sunday afternoon and end at noon on Saturday. As a worker, you will be asked to do at least 6 hours of work daily. These 6 hours should reflect actual work, not the time you spend in other activites.
